Real-time Transport Control Protocol (rtcp)

Table 242. Real-time Transport Control Protocol (rtcp)

FieldField NameTypeDescription
rtcp.app.dataApplication specific dataByte array 
rtcp.app.nameName (ASCII)String 
rtcp.app.subtypeSubtypeUnsigned 8-bit integer 
rtcp.lengthLengthUnsigned 16-bit integer 
rtcp.nack.blpBitmask of following lost packetsUnsigned 16-bit integer 
rtcp.nack.fsnFirst sequence numberUnsigned 16-bit integer 
rtcp.paddingPaddingBoolean 
rtcp.padding.countPadding countUnsigned 8-bit integer 
rtcp.padding.dataPadding dataByte array 
rtcp.ptPacket typeUnsigned 8-bit integer 
rtcp.rcReception report countUnsigned 8-bit integer 
rtcp.scSource countUnsigned 8-bit integer 
rtcp.sdes.lengthLengthUnsigned 32-bit integer 
rtcp.sdes.prefix.lengthPrefix lengthUnsigned 8-bit integer 
rtcp.sdes.prefix.stringPrefix stringString 
rtcp.sdes.ssrc_csrcSSRC / CSRC identifierUnsigned 32-bit integer 
rtcp.sdes.textTextString 
rtcp.sdes.typeTypeUnsigned 8-bit integer 
rtcp.sender.octetcountSender's octet countUnsigned 32-bit integer 
rtcp.sender.packetcountSender's packet countUnsigned 32-bit integer 
rtcp.senderssrcSender SSRCUnsigned 32-bit integer 
rtcp.ssrc.cum_nrCumulative number of packets lostUnsigned 32-bit integer 
rtcp.ssrc.dlsrDelay since last SR timestampUnsigned 32-bit integer 
rtcp.ssrc.ext_highExtended highest sequence number receivedUnsigned 32-bit integer 
rtcp.ssrc.fractionFraction lostUnsigned 8-bit integer 
rtcp.ssrc.high_cyclesSequence number cycles countUnsigned 16-bit integer 
rtcp.ssrc.high_seqHighest sequence number receivedUnsigned 16-bit integer 
rtcp.ssrc.identifierIdentifierUnsigned 32-bit integer 
rtcp.ssrc.jitterInterarrival jitterUnsigned 32-bit integer 
rtcp.ssrc.lsrLast SR timestampUnsigned 32-bit integer 
rtcp.timestamp.ntpNTP timestampString 
rtcp.timestamp.rtpRTP timestampUnsigned 32-bit integer 
rtcp.versionVersionUnsigned 8-bit integer